    Using an existing domain there is a reasonable amount of traffic and enquiries but not from the UK.

    I have managed to secure a very keyword rich .co.uk domain and need to know how best to utilise this.

    Do I simply point the domain at the website or create a very keyword rich micro site with links back to the main site?

    What is the best way to approach this?

    You have two options as you say

    1/ 301 redirect the domain to your main site...and do a linkbuilding campaign using the new domain and your chosen keywords.
    if you think it may get type in traffic, redirect is also good

    2/ the better option I would say, is to create a small site with the domain and optimise it as a seperate site. Link from there to your main site in a 'some' key places on the site.
    Build backlinks to this domain targetting your keywords
    Dont create a dodgy looking link network site (make it natural)
    Dont overstuff the pages with keywords.
    use good page title and descriptions
    Host the site on a clean UK IP address


    if you are trying to get more UK traffic for your other domain:
    have you....
    In webmaster tools -> select UK as your sites target location....(thanks ssandecki ;) )
    Host the site on a UK server
